USS Nevada (BB36) was the one my grandmother's youngest brother served on. GMC3 Flavious Johnson stationed at Turret 1 (the forwrad battery of 14-inch guns). He was killed at Pearl Harbor, 12/7/41 having just turned twenty years old in October of that year.

The Nevada saw a good bit of action in the North Atlantic for the second half of the war and was one of the ships used in the atom bomb test at Bikini Atoll. She was heavily damaged in the test and showed high readings of radioactivity. She was sunk in about 14,000 feet of water in naval gunnery practice in 1946.
